What is a sample frame?

A list of all eligable sampling units from which the sample can be drawn (eg telephone directories, electronic registers, company lists, club membership lists etc)

What does a market demand schedule show?

A market demand schedule is a table that lists the quantity of a good all consumers in a market will buy at each different price.
